New campus in five years

Finally there is a big relief for students of the College of Engineering as the Ministry of Works, Municipalities Affairs and Urban Planning has begun work on the project to entirely relocate its campus from Isa Town to Sakhir.

Sources say the work, which is expected to cost the government BD35 million, will be completed within five years. The move comes after 32 years of the opening of the college in Isa Town. There has been a lot of complaints about the lack of facilities at the present campus.

Speaking to Tribune, Abdul Bader Khonji, head of the college said that the buildings have grown old and need huge maintenance works.
